One info for You coming in Rijeka.
For those who are planning to buy ticket for the game at the stadium, working hours are as follows:
Western entrance (main entrance on stadium):
- every working day 16-21 h
- game day starting at 17.00
Eastern entrance:
- only on game day, starting at 18.30
Credit cards and cash accepted.
